Part 1: UFO
I chose this gamemode as I believe it’s the most versatile out of the three (the cube and spider don’t allow for midair inputs, for instance). I care about this as I want the gameplay to match the complexity of the music during the drop. However, due to the UFO’s difficulty to move vertically to further match the song intensity, I had to compensate by frequently using dash orbs, spider orbs and s l o p e s.

Part 2: Ball
Because the music modulates to a lower key at this point and therefore feels less intense, I chose a more limiting gamemode, better suited to more corridor-like gameplay. The robot is far more of a different gamemode from the UFO than the music justifies, so I didn’t think it would create as good of a transition. Additionally, the wave is too vertical, sharp and snappy for this part of the music.

Part 3: UFO
I chose the UFO once again, because of how part 3 of the music is similar to part 1. But even so, both the swing and ship move too smoothly for music like this.

Part 4: Robot
The robot, like I have said before, has many differences from the UFO gamemode (e.g. you can’t hit your head without H blocks). This time, I believe it’s justified since the music prepares to transition to a much calmer section. Additionally, the many properties it shares with the cube allows for a good transition to a hypothetical cube section after the level, where it fits due to its simplicity. I didn’t choose the spider due to the unfitting abundance of snappy, vertical movement. I didn’t choose the swing because it’s too similar to the UFO.
